Established 1883 Walker Park, Nunawading PO Box 2001 Rangeview Vic, 3132 Website www.mitchamcc.vic.cricket.com.au mitchamcc@hotmail.com President Ken O Meara 0408 067 498 Secretary Steve Simpson 0418 363 538 Finals Close For Tiger Juniors As we approach the final home and away round of the cricket season, it is pleasing to see many of Mitcham s junior teams in contention for a finals berth. It all comes down to the last game for the under 14A and 14B (Sat) teams where a win will secure a top 4 position while the under 12A and 12B sides have locked in their spots in the top 4. Unfortunately the under 16A and under 14B (Fri) Tigers will not be part of the finals but will at least finish closer to the top 4 than the bottom of the ladder. As usual there have been some very good individual performances in rounds 6, 7 and 8 so please check out all the names inside this newsletter. Well done to the many boys who have made their top score or taken their best bowling figures during the season. Please take note of the date for JUNIOR PRESENTATION Sunday 26 th March which will be held in two shifts over the afternoon and evening. This is due to the fact that we have too many teams from under 10 s up to 16 s to hold their presentations together as in the past especially without the oval for the kids to run around on. See details inside this newsletter. The senior and junior committees of the club have recently been working on a framework for the position of Junior Coaching Coordinator for next season. The club intends to devote significant resources to ensure we find the best person to fill this position and continue to effectively develop our junior cricketers. To all teams, players and coaches, whether involved the finals or not, good luck for your upcoming games and well done on your efforts over the season. Go Tigers! Mitcham C.C. Outstanding Performances In Juniors There were two outstanding achievements by Mitcham junior cricketers over the last 3 rounds which rank with any in the club s junior history. Well done to Alistair Hardie who scored his first century, 104 in the under 16A s round 7 game against Heathmont. Not satisfied with one ton, Al then proceeded to match it in the afternoon. Playing in the club s 3 rd XI against Kerrimuir United he scored 112 and shared a match-winning partnership of 203 with captain Andy Cumming. It is almost certain that Al s achievement of two centuries in the one day has never been matched in Mitcham s history. On the day of his 12 th birthday, under 12A left-arm fast bowler Luke Tully produced a 2 over spell as destructive as you would see in cricket. With Heathmont s score at 1/13 off 12 overs when Luke came on to bowl, his ball by ball bowling analysis then read:.. x 1. x x x x. x. Heathmont s innings had plummeted to 8/15 as Luke took figures of 6 for 1 off 2 overs including a double hat-trick and a quadruple wicket maiden. Five of Luke s wickets were bowled and 1 was lbw. He later returned for a third over which went for 5 runs giving him final figures of 6 for 6 as Heathmont were bowled out for 30. Mitcham went on to win the game by 140 runs on the 1 st innings but missed out by a solitary wicket in achieving an outright victory. Incredibly Luke had also taken a hat-trick in figures of 5 for 14 two days previously playing in an under 14 RDCA T20 game for Heathmont Baptists against St.Andrews. Luke s feat is probably also a unique one at Mitcham C.C. as there is no record of a junior bowler ever having taken a double hat-trick previously. Congratulations to both Alistair and Luke. From left: Cal Pietersen, Luke Tully & Brad Oakes Under 10 s Update It would be harder to believe how quickly the season has passed, if not for the noticeable improvement in the skills and game awareness of our Under 10 Tigers. Throughout the season, we have focused on bowling with the correct action, playing proper cricket shots when batting, and staying involved in the field. All of our boys have bowled at least one batsman, can all play beautiful front-foot drives, and have all had at least one direct-hit run out or catch in the field. We continue to be the best presented Under 10 team in the East, and enjoy our cricket with the support of a friendly group of parents. Many of the boys are already looking forward to making the step to Under 12 s, with scores, wins and losses, and ladders. Anthony Grace (Under 10 Black team coach)
